optical density noun[ U or Cusually singular ] physics specializeduk /ˌɒp.tɪ.kəl ˈden.sɪ.ti/ us /ˌɑːp.tɪ.kəl ˈden.sə.t̬i/(abbreviationOD) the degree to which an object or material reduces the intensity of light passing through it: 光密度 The slower that light is able to travel through a given medium, the higher the optical density of the medium.光在特定介质中传播的速度越慢,介质的光密度越高。 The area and average optical density of each fibre is measured.测量每根光纤的面积和平均光密度。 A microdensitometer was used which measured the optical density of the films. The opalescence arises when rays of light strike thin films having an optical density differing from that of the main mass. The optical density of the batch culture was determined using a spectrophotometer.
